Transaction f8578072e0601fbb2a66a1e8e21f56cf8f8f3cd1619ef6b0647996cd904592be
1 Input
1 Output
-
f8578072e0601fbb2a66a1e8e21f56cf8f8f3cd1619ef6b0647996cd904592be:0
- value
- 81863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87c2d8c1f45e269a3c46fd72bab5843ad4d685e8 OP_EQUAL
- address
- 3E4rZdMRbYEXMmgBe4kSqRR14DkKEkfpgs